On 07.03.19 15:10, Richard Henderson wrote:
> On 3/7/19 4:15 AM, David Hildenbrand wrote:
>> +void probe_write_access(CPUS390XState *env, uint64_t addr, uint64_t len,
>> + uintptr_t ra)
>> +{
>> +#ifdef CONFIG_USER_ONLY
>> + if (!h2g_valid(addr) || !h2g_valid(addr + len - 1)) {
>> + s390_program_interrupt(env, PGM_ADDRESSING, ILEN_AUTO, ra);
>> + }
>
> You need
>
> || page_check_range(addr, len, PAGE_WRITE) < 0
>
> as well.
Indeed, thanks.
So it should be
+void probe_write_access(CPUS390XState *env, uint64_t addr, uint64_t len,
+ uintptr_t ra)
+{
+#ifdef CONFIG_USER_ONLY
+ if (!h2g_valid(addr) || !h2g_valid(addr + len - 1) ||
+ page_check_range(addr, len, PAGE_WRITE) < 0) {
+ s390_program_interrupt(env, PGM_ADDRESSING, ILEN_AUTO, ra);
+ }
+#else
+ /* test the actual access, not just any access to the page due to LAP */
+ while (len) {
+ const uint64_t pagelen = -(addr | -TARGET_PAGE_MASK);
+ const uint64_t curlen = MIN(pagelen, len);
+
+ probe_write(env, addr, curlen, cpu_mmu_index(env, false), ra);
+ addr = wrap_address(env, addr + curlen);
+ len -= curlen;
+ }
+#endif
+}
